Why PES 6 Still Rocks
Before we dive into the how-to, let's explore why PES 6 continues to captivate gamers worldwide. The charm of PES 6 lies in its simplicity and depth. Unlike modern football games loaded with complex mechanics and endless features, PES 6 focuses on what truly matters: the beautiful game itself. The fluid player movements, the realistic ball physics, and the strategic team management create an immersive experience that keeps you hooked for hours. The Master League mode, a cornerstone of the PES franchise, allows you to build your dream team from scratch, nurturing young talents and leading them to glory. The editing capabilities are also top-notch, enabling you to customize everything from team kits to player appearances. This level of personalization adds a unique touch, making each playthrough feel special and tailored to your preferences. Many dedicated communities still thrive around PES 6, updating rosters, creating stunning graphics, and organizing online tournaments. This vibrant community support ensures that the game remains fresh and exciting, even after all these years. Preparing Your PS2 for PES 6
So, you've got your hands on a legitimate copy of PES 6. Awesome! Now, how do you get it running on your PS2? If you own an original PS2 console, you'll need to burn the downloaded ISO file onto a DVD. This process requires a DVD burner, a blank DVD-R disc, and burning software like ImgBurn (which is free and highly recommended). Open ImgBurn, select the "Write image file to disc" option, and choose the PES 6 ISO file you downloaded. Make sure to set the burning speed to a low value (like 4x or 8x) to minimize the risk of errors during the burning process. A slower burn speed often results in a more reliable disc. Once the burning process is complete, insert the DVD into your PS2 and power on the console. If your PS2 is modded or chipped, it should automatically recognize and run the game. If not, you may need to use a swap trick or other method to bypass the PS2's security measures. Keep in mind that using modchips or performing swap tricks may void your console's warranty or potentially damage it, so proceed with caution and do your research beforehand. Alternatively, if you don't have a physical PS2 console, you can play PES 6 on your computer using a PS2 emulator like PCSX2. This option offers several advantages, including enhanced graphics, customizable controls, and the ability to save your game progress to your hard drive. Setting up PCSX2 can be a bit technical, but there are plenty of online tutorials and guides available to walk you through the process. Once you've configured the emulator, simply load the PES 6 ISO file and start playing. Using an Emulator: A Modern Twist
Okay, so maybe dusting off your old PS2 isn't your thing. No sweat! Emulators are here to save the day. Think of an emulator as a virtual PS2 living inside your computer. One of the most popular and reliable PS2 emulators is PCSX2. It's free, open-source, and packs a punch in terms of features. To get started, download the latest version of PCSX2 from its official website. Once downloaded, follow the installation instructions carefully. You'll need to configure the emulator's settings to match your computer's specifications. This involves selecting the appropriate graphics and audio plugins, as well as setting up your controller. Don't worry; there are tons of online guides and tutorials to help you through this process. Once PCSX2 is set up, you'll need a BIOS file. This file is essential for the emulator to mimic the PS2's hardware accurately. However, obtaining a BIOS file can be tricky, as it's technically copyrighted material. You may need to extract it from your own PS2 console or search for it online at your own risk. With PCSX2 configured and the BIOS file in place, you're ready to load up PES 6. Simply select the ISO file you downloaded earlier, and the game should start running in the emulator. Emulators offer several advantages over playing on a physical console. You can upscale the graphics to higher resolutions, apply anti-aliasing filters to smooth out jagged edges, and even use custom shaders to enhance the visuals. You can also save your game progress at any point, making it easy to pick up where you left off. Plus, emulators often support features like save states, allowing you to rewind the game to correct mistakes or experiment with different strategies. Controller Setup: Get Your Game On
Now, let's talk controllers. Playing PES 6 with a keyboard can be a bit clunky, so I highly recommend using a gamepad. The good news is that PCSX2 supports a wide range of controllers, including Xbox, PlayStation, and generic USB gamepads. To set up your controller, go to the PCSX2 configuration menu and select the "Controllers" option. Here, you can map the buttons on your gamepad to the corresponding functions in the game. Take your time to configure the controls to your liking. Experiment with different button layouts to find what feels most comfortable and intuitive for you. Once you've mapped the buttons, test them out in the game to make sure everything is working correctly. Pay attention to the analog sticks, as they are crucial for player movement and dribbling. Adjust the sensitivity settings if needed to fine-tune the controls to your preferences. If you're using an Xbox controller, you may need to install additional drivers to ensure it's properly recognized by PCSX2. These drivers are usually available on Microsoft's website. For PlayStation controllers, you can use software like DS4Windows to emulate an Xbox controller, allowing you to use your DualShock 4 or DualSense controller with PCSX2. Generic USB gamepads may require some trial and error to configure correctly, but with a bit of patience, you should be able to get them working. Remember to save your controller configuration once you're satisfied with the settings. This will ensure that your preferences are saved for future gaming sessions. Customization and Mods: Level Up Your Game
Want to take your PES 6 experience to the next level? Mods are your best friend! The PES 6 community is incredibly active and has created a plethora of mods that enhance various aspects of the game. These mods can update team rosters, add new kits, improve graphics, and even tweak gameplay mechanics. To install mods, you'll typically need to download the mod files from a reputable source and then use a special tool to apply them to your PES 6 installation. Some popular modding tools include DKZ Studio and Game Graphic Studio. These tools allow you to import and export files from the game's ISO image, making it easy to replace existing content with custom content. When installing mods, it's crucial to follow the instructions carefully. Make sure to back up your original PES 6 files before applying any mods, in case something goes wrong. Read the mod's documentation to understand what changes it makes and how to install it correctly. Some mods may require specific versions of PES 6 or other mods to be installed first. Be aware that installing too many mods at once can sometimes cause conflicts or instability. It's best to install mods one at a time and test the game after each installation to ensure everything is working properly. Popular mods for PES 6 include roster updates that bring the team lineups up to date with the latest transfers, graphic enhancements that improve the visual quality of the game, and gameplay tweaks that adjust the AI behavior or ball physics. You can also find mods that add new stadiums, balls, and player faces.
